神经炎症反应在术后认知功能障碍中作用的研究进展 被引量:8

Research progression of the role of neuroinflammation in postoperative cognitive dysfunction

摘要 背景在老年患者的心脏手术和非心脏手术中,术后认知功能障(postoperative cognitive dysfunction,POCD)已经成为一种常见的并发症。POCD导致患者并发症增加,医疗消耗增加,患者病死率升高。近年来大量研究发现POCD各种发病机制都通过一个共同通路即神经炎症。目的进一步研究神经炎症反应对POCD发生、发展的作用机制和防治措施。内容以神经炎症反应为中心,围绕神经炎症、炎症因子、抗炎和炎症抑制反应对POCD的影响进行综述。趋向预防性抗炎治疗防止POCD的发生、发展。 Background Postoperative cognitive dysfunction(POCD) often occurs in elderly patients who had cardiac or noncardiac surgeries. POCD results in an increasing of morbidity and mortality and requires more healthcare resources. Recent studies suggest that neuroinflammation plays a major role in POCD. Objective Further investigation of the mechanism of neuroinflammation in POCD and preventive strategies. Content This article reviewed the impact of neuroinflammation, inflammation cytokines, anti-inflammation and inflammation suppression on POCD. Trend Prophylactic administration of antiinflammation drugs as a preventive strategy of POCD.
